GST 2.0 Resets India Bike Prices: Honda Trims 300cc Tags as Premium BMW and Honda Models Get Costlier

The new two-rate GST sets 18% for sub-350cc, 40% for larger bikes, driving immediate price resets across line-ups.

Overview

  • Honda cut the CB300R to Rs 2.19 lakh (down Rs 21,000) and the CB300F to Rs 1.55 lakh (down Rs 15,000), reflecting the lower slab for sub-350cc models.
  • Honda’s BigWing range above 350cc now carries higher tags, with increases up to Rs 2.92 lakh on the GL1800 Gold Wing Tour and Rs 2.19 lakh on the CBR1000RR-R Fireblade SP.
  • BMW Motorrad raised prices across most of its portfolio by Rs 95,000 to Rs 3.13 lakh, while only the G 310 R and the 350cc C 400 GT saw reductions.
  • Kawasaki announced reductions on select sub-350cc models, including roughly Rs 31,000 off the KLX230 and about Rs 30,900 off the Versys-X 300.
  • Honda launched the CB350C Special Edition at about Rs 2.02 lakh (ex-showroom, Bengaluru), opened bookings, scheduled deliveries for early October, and rebranded the base CB350 line as CB350C.
